§ 627.516 — Advance payment of premiums

Text

Each insurer shall allow a refund or discount on advance premiums paid for an industrial life insurance policy if such premiums are paid in a single sum covering a period of at least 13 weeks. Such refund or discount shall reflect the difference in costs between weekly or monthly premium payment and the advance premiums being paid, with an interest factor used to reflect the time value of money.

Legislative History

s. 522, ch. 59-205; s. 3, ch. 76-168; s. 1, ch. 77-457; s. 2, ch. 80-156; ss. 2, 3, ch. 81-318; ss. 420, 809(2nd), ch. 82-243; s. 79, ch. 82-386; s. 114, ch. 92-318.
